Guangzhou, December 16 (China Youth Daily) -- Today, the first exhibition of young calligraphy and seal engraving works in Guangdong Province opened in Sui, and the exhibition of works focused on displaying a number of excellent works of calligraphy and seal carvings of young people in Guangdong. At the scene, the organizer presented awards to the award-winning young artists.

Liu Jianbo, chairman of the Guangdong Young Calligraphers Association, said that the Guangdong Young Calligraphers Association puts serving young people in the first place in its work. In addition to this exhibition, it also continued to organize brand activities such as "100 Calligraphy Charity Lectures", "Young Calligraphers Welcoming Spring Blessing Series Activities", "Guangdong Province's First Invitation Exhibition of Hand-scrolled Calligraphy Works of Young Calligraphy", and edited and issued 9 issues of Guangdong Youth Calligraphy Magazine, actively building a growth platform for young calligraphers.
Among the selected works, all the characters of the seal are available, and each work has different brushwork, orthography, chapter method, ink method, and shape system. The connotation of the work is rooted in tradition, diverse and inclusive. At the scene, the calligraphers exchanged views and stopped for a long time in front of the exquisite works.
The organizers said that the event aims to vigorously promote traditional culture among the vast number of young people, enhance cultural self-confidence, and comprehensively display the creative strength of youth calligraphy in Guangdong Province. Since the launch of the campaign, the organizers have received 1375 submissions from young calligraphers in Guangdong Province, and after the preliminary evaluation, re-evaluation and final evaluation of the jury, a total of 10 award-winning works, 20 nomination award works and 229 works in the exhibition have been evaluated.
Under the guidance of the Guangdong Provincial Committee of the Youth League, the exhibition is sponsored by the Guangdong Young Calligraphers Association. At the same time, 67 specially invited works from the Guangdong Calligraphers Association, the Guangdong Young Calligraphers Association and the Young Calligraphers Association of various cities in Guangdong Province were also exhibited. The exhibition is valid from now until 21 December.
